Our Vision is to provide the best mental health, learning disability, autism and community based services for the populations we serve.

As an integrated mental health, learning disability and community Trust, Lancashire and South Cumbria NHS Foundation Trust provides a range of services including:

•    Primary and secondary mental health care for children and adults including specialist inpatient child and adolescent mental health provision, perinatal mental health, forensic services including low and medium secure care.
•    Specialist community support for children and adults with learning disabilities and autism, including intensive support.
•    Community physical health and well-being services for children and adults.

The Trust was first established in 2002 and employs approximately 7,000 staff who provide care from more than 400 sites. The organisation offers opportunities for medics, mental health and general nurses, allied health professionals, psychology, administration and clerical staff, apprentices and volunteers.

Job overview

Post:  Receptionist
Location: Garburn House Outpatients Reception, Westmorland General Hospital
Banding: Band 2
Hours: 15 hrs


An exciting opportunity has arisen for a receptionist based at Garburn House Outpatients.  The post is for Monday and Tuesday 9am – 5pm

We are inviting applications from individuals with excellent organisation skills, ability to work on your own or as a member of the wider admin team.  The successful candidate will be able to communication with staff, servicer users, visitors and carers in a professional manner.  The successful candidate must be computer literate, able to use Microsoft office packages and a good telephone manner.

Person specification

Education

Essential criteria
  • NVQ Level 2 in Customer Care – or equivalent experience
  • Willingness to commit to continuous personal development

Knowledge

Essential criteria
  • Knowledge of administrative systems and processes
  • Understanding of confidentiality within the workplace
Desirable criteria
  • Knowledge of mental health services

Experience

Essential criteria
  • Previous experience in customer services or administration
Desirable criteria
  • Previous experience as a receptionist
